Responsible for coding claims for professional fees for practice based physicians or other entities. Reviews professional documentation for accurate CPT, HCPCS, and ICD-10 CM coding that adheres to coding compliance guidelines for accurate, timely, and consistent codes. Maintain CEUs for AAPC Membership/Certification. Ability to look up CPT, HCPCS, and ICD-10 CM codes from online service or using traditional coding references. Manage time to meet productivity standards to ensure coding is within departmental goal. Assist billing department with coding denials/appeals from various payors to ensure optimum reimbursement for documented services. Mains knowledge of payor coding and billing guidelines for assigned specialties. Communicates coding trends or problems identified as impacting reimbursement to the management team. Able to serve as a resource to other coding specialists. Develop working relationship with physicians/providers and office staff. Regularly meets with the Coding Manager to discuss and resolve coding issues or obstacles. Knowledge of billing guidelines and requirements for all payors. Work Schedule: 80 hours bi-weekly Founded in 1906, McLeod Health is a locally owned and managed, not for profit organization supported by the strength of more than 900 members on its medical staff and more than 2,900 licensed nurses. McLeod Health is also composed of approximately 15,000 team members and more than 90 physician practices throughout its 18-county service area. With seven hospitals, McLeod Health operates three Health and Fitness Centers, a Sports Medicine and Outpatient Rehabilitation Center, Hospice and Home Health Services. The system currently has 988 licensed beds, including Hospice and Behavioral Health. The hospitals within McLeod Health include: McLeod Regional Medical Center, McLeod Health Dillon, McLeod Health Loris, McLeod Health Seacoast, McLeod Health Cheraw, McLeod Health Clarendon and McLeod Behavioral Health.
